Comparison Analysis

Henderson State University and Shawnee State University have similar earnings, with Henderson State graduates earning $35,194 and Shawnee State graduates earning $35,080. Henderson State has a lower tuition of $7,885 compared to Shawnee State's $9,622. Both schools have the same graduation rate of 38.7%. Henderson State has an acceptance rate of 81.9%. The acceptance rate for Shawnee State is not provided.

Henderson State University appears to be the better value based on the provided data. Henderson State has lower tuition while maintaining similar earnings and graduation rates. The acceptance rate is higher at Henderson State.

Students may consider tuition costs and potential earnings when deciding between these schools. The graduation rate is another factor to consider.
